Top 5 Cat Games in Africa Q4 2022
In Q4 2022, the top 5 cat games on a unified platform in Africa showed varied performance trends in downloads, revenue, and active users.
In Q4 2022, the top 5 cat games on a unified platform in Africa exhibited diverse performance trends across weekly downloads, revenue, and active users. The data, sourced from Sensor Tower, provides a detailed look into these trends.
My Cat – Virtual Pet Games saw a gradual increase in weekly revenue, starting at $585 and peaking at $832 by the end of December. Weekly downloads fluctuated, with notable peaks in early October at 3.7K and late December at 3.7K. Active users showcased a similar trend, beginning at 10.3K and rising to 13.9K by the last week of December.
My Talking Tom 2 experienced a steady increase in weekly revenue, reaching a high of $609 in mid-December. Weekly downloads showed consistent growth, starting at 105.6K and ending the quarter at 118.7K. Active users remained strong, maintaining numbers between 1.5M and 1.7M throughout the quarter.
The Battle Cats had a varied revenue trend, peaking at $533 in early October and stabilizing around $386 by the end of December. Downloads were modest, with the highest at 1.3K in early October. Active users remained relatively stable, fluctuating between 2.2K and 2.5K.
My Talking Angela 2 displayed consistent weekly revenue, reaching $404 in mid-December. Downloads rose steadily, peaking at 96.8K in the last week of December. Active users increased from 703K in late September to 725K by the end of the quarter.
Kitten Match showed a gradual increase in weekly revenue, peaking at $469 in the final week of December. Downloads were highest in late December at 883. Active users saw a general decline, starting at 23.9K and ending the quarter at 15.6K.
